Veterans Park & Lakefront Trail
Veterans Park is one of Milwaukee’s most picturesque outdoor spaces, featuring a lagoon, kite-flying area, and direct access to the Oak Leaf and Lakefront Trails.
Milwaukee RiverWalk
The Milwaukee RiverWalk winds through downtown, connecting neighborhoods like the Third Ward and Beerline.
Henry Maier Festival Park (Summerfest Grounds)
The Henry Maier Festival Park hosts Summerfest, the world’s largest music festival, along with numerous cultural events and concerts throughout the year.
Cathedral Square Park
Cathedral Square Park is a lively downtown green space hosting events like Jazz in the Park and Milwaukee’s holiday lighting festival.
Milwaukee Public Market
Located in the Historic Third Ward, the Milwaukee Public Market is a culinary destination featuring fresh produce, artisan foods, specialty coffee, and regional wines.
Pabst Theater
Built in 1895, the Pabst Theater is a nationally recognized performing arts landmark, presenting concerts, stand-up comedy, and special events in an ornate European-style setting.
Fiserv Forum
The Fiserv Forum is Milwaukee’s world-class arena and home to the NBA’s Milwaukee Bucks, Marquette University basketball, and major concert tours.
Bradford Beach
Bradford Beach is one of Milwaukee’s most popular summer attractions, offering volleyball courts, beach cabanas, and open-air dining.
Discovery World
Discovery World inspires curiosity through interactive science and technology exhibits, a large freshwater aquarium, and hands-on experiences for all ages.
Northwestern Mutual Headquarters
The Northwestern Mutual Tower and Commons is the centerpiece of Milwaukee’s business district and home to one of America’s leading financial services firms.
Milwaukee Art Museum
A Milwaukee landmark on the Lake Michigan shoreline, the Milwaukee Art Museum combines classic and modern architecture, highlighted by Santiago Calatrava’s stunning winged design.
